Can someone give me information on Spring Banch Independent School District in Houston, Texas?

I'm a teacher that is looking to move to the Houston area next school term. I don't want to live too far from downtown but would like to teach in a fairly good area (I currently teach in a very depressed school and region). I like the location of the Spring Branch District. However, I have seen good and bad things about the district. What information can you all give? Thanks in advance.

You can get a lot of good information on Spring Branch ISD from the Texas Education Agengy (TEA) website (below). Click on "Accountability" and select in particular the first two categories (AEIS and Accountability Ratings). The Houston Chronicle also just ran a special section on local school ratings. You might be able to access it online at the Chronicle's website. One note: if you plan to work in Spring Branch, I wouldn't recommend living near downtown, since that would be a terrible commute twice a day down I-10 or Memorial Drive. There is a lot of excellent and affordable housing in the Spring Branch area; I'd recommend checking out local real estate listings.

The good things about the district are south of I-10. The bad things are north of I-10. I realize you may have no input as to where you teach, but the south side definitely beats the "north of the tracks" area, as we used to call it. Oh, and you don't want to live near downtown and teach in SBISD. The traffic would be a bear. If you relish hourlong commutes then fine...
